Spider Walk

When: Sunday, Sept. 2, 2007, 8 p.m. to 10 p.m.

Where: Lake Mineral Wells State Park and Trailway, 100 Park Road 71, Mineral Wells

Categories:

Description

Learn the importance of spiders in the wild as Park Interpreter David Owens shows slides and talks about the different types of spiders, focusing on wolf spiders. Afterward, take a walk down the trailway with flashlights watching for the eye shine reflection of the park's wolf spiders.
